Transaction 3f11fb58db42bf8c3d3614bc29ffe7eeb42d0f3d741b0afe16be0ca664d98e11
1 Input
1 Output
-
3f11fb58db42bf8c3d3614bc29ffe7eeb42d0f3d741b0afe16be0ca664d98e11:0
- value
- 625066773
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c621993faaba1af3e6a1d1f30f53e47a7a7b0676 OP_EQUAL
- address
- 3KkdxzwSNPoELeMZsoMzKGajHtV6FDDHAP